Hi there,
To make sure we guide you correctly, could you confirm where you purchased the domain—was it directly through WordPress.com, or through another domain registrar?
The EPP code (also known as an Auth ID) is used when transferring a domain from one registrar to another. To help us investigate, could you share the domain name you purchased? You can also visit https://wordpress.com/site-profiler and enter the domain name to see which company it was registered through.
If you did purchase the domain through WordPress.com and you’re having trouble accessing the account, we will need to help you recover the account. Please follow the steps in this guide to get started with account recovery: Recover your account
Our team will help you recover access to your WordPress.com account. -
